Reported by Earnest I Aguilar Since 1988, 24 years of Royal Rumble greatness has occurred with some of the greatest special entries, surprise winners, and the craziest way to start the year. The 25th year of greatness continues tonight. 30 men try to claim the one guaranteed ticket to WrestleMania in Miami, Florida. There is only one Road to WrestleMania, the starting line starts tonight, it's Royal Rumble time. The Royal Rumble entry number with the most wins is No. 27. Big John Studd (1989), Yokozuna (1993), Bret "Hit Man" Hart (1994) and "Stone Cold" Steve Austin (2001) all entered with this very number. Rey Mysterio has the longest recorded time in the Royal Rumble with 1:02:12 in 2006. Santino Marella has the shortest recorded time in the ring with just 1.9 seconds in 2009. The match is based on the traditional battle royal match, in which a set number of participants (30) aim at eliminating their competitors by tossing them over the top rope, with both feet touching the floor. The winner of the event is the last participant remaining after all others have been eliminated. The Royal Rumble contestants do not enter the ring at the same time but instead are assigned entry numbers, usually via a lottery, although they can win guaranteed desirable spots via a number of other means, the most common being winning a match or in one certain case for this year, losing a match. The match begins with the two participants who have drawn entry numbers one and two, with the remaining competitors entering the ring at regular 90 second intervals.
